Clashes near encounter site in Pulwama 15 Year old boy killed, Train service suspended

Clashes erupted near the site of an encounter between militants and government forces in Padgampora village of south Kashmir’s Pulwama district on Thursday.
Youth took to streets and clashed with forces to disrupt the anti-militant operation.
Meanwhile, reports said that the family of Lashkar-e-Toiba militant Shafi Shergujri of Banderpora has been brought near the encounter site to persuade him to surrender.
Shafi is reportedly trapped in a house which has been cordoned off by the forces.

A young boy was killed during clashes near the encounter site in Padgampora village of south Kashmir’s Pulwama district on Thursday.
The deceased was identified as 15-year-old Amir Nazir of Beegumbagh Kakapora.
He was a student of ninth standard.
Chief Medical Officer (CMO) Pulwama Talat Jabeen said the boy was declared dead on arrival at PHC Kakapora.
Local reports said that another civilian has sustained a bullet injury in his leg. He was shifted to Srinagar for treatment, they said.

Train service from Budgam-Srinagar to Banihal in Jammu region was suspended Thursday for security reasons following encounter between militants and forces in south Kashmir’s Pulwama district.
However, train service on Srinagar-Badgam in the central Kashmir to Baramulla in north was running as per schedule, a railway official told Kashmir Post.
He said all trains running on Budgam-Srinagar-Pulwama, Anantnag and Qazigund to Banihal in Jammu region have been suspended.
